What is a Built-in Electric Oven?
A built-in electric oven is an appliance that is installed straight into the kitchen cabinetry rather than being free-standing. This design enables a cleaner, more structured look in the kitchen. Built-in electric ovens can be put at different heights, using ergonomic benefits and enhancing availability for various tasks, including baking, broiling, and roasting.
Secret Features of Built-in Electric Ovens
Built-in electric ovens are packed with features created to raise cooking experiences. These include:
- Variability in Styles and Sizes: Available in different styles (single, double, wall) and sizes, built-in ovens can fit any kitchen layout and design.
- Advanced Cooking Technologies: Many designs feature convection cooking, steam cooking, and accuracy temperature manages to enhance cooking performance.
- User-Friendly Controls: With digital screens and touch controls, built-in ovens permit exact adjustments and cooking timers.
- Self-Cleaning Options: Some built-in electric ovens are geared up with self-cleaning cycles that make upkeep a breeze.
- Smart Technology Integration: Modern built-in ovens might include wise capabilities, allowing users to keep track of cooking from another location via smart device apps.
Benefits of Built-in Electric Ovens
Space Efficiency: Built-in electric ovens conserve flooring space, making them ideal for smaller sized cooking areas where square video is limited. Their style permits taking full advantage of cabinet space above and below.
Aesthetic Appeal: The smooth and integrated appearance of built-in ovens matches modern kitchen styles, providing a seamless transition in between appliances and cabinetry.
Increased Functionality: With different setups (e.g., double ovens), homeowners can prepare numerous meals at different temperature levels all at once, improving meal preparation efficiency.
Enhanced Accessibility: built in oven-in electric ovens can be installed at eye level, making it much easier to examine dishes without flexing down, therefore decreasing stress.
Safety: Built-in ovens are usually created to have solid setup, lowering the danger of toppling. In addition, features like cool-to-the-touch doors enhance safety, especially in homes with children.
Selecting the Right Built-in Electric Oven
When choosing the ideal built-in electric oven, different factors must be thought about. Here's a list of important requirements:
- Size and Dimensions: Measure the offered space in the kitchen and make sure the chosen oven built in fits properly.
- Capacity: Consider the volume of cooking required for family size or entertaining.
- Cooking Features: Evaluate the particular cooking functions needed, like convection modes or additional racks.
- Design Preference: Choose between various styles and finishes that will match the kitchen's visual.
- Warranty and Customer Support: Research the producer's guarantee and schedule of consumer support for repair and maintenance.

Maintenance and Care for Built-in Electric Ovens
To make sure durability and optimum efficiency, regular maintenance of built-in electric ovens is important. Here are some suggestions for care:
- Regular Cleaning: Wipe down surfaces after each usage to prevent build-up. Usage appropriate cleaners for the oven interiors and exteriors.
- Inspect Seals and Gaskets: Inspect door seals occasionally to guarantee they are intact to keep cooking effectiveness.
- Calibrate the Oven: Check oven built in temperatures with an oven thermometer to ensure it's cooking at the correct temperature level.
- Follow the Manufacturer's Guidelines: Adhere to operating standards provided by the producer for safe and efficient use.
FAQs About Built-in Electric Ovens
Q1: Are electric ovens more energy-efficient than gas ovens?A1: Generally, Built-In Oven electric ovens can be more energy-efficient due to the fact that they warm more uniformly and maintain temperature level better as soon as warmed. However, this can differ based on use patterns and specific models. Q2: Can built-in electric ovens be repaired?A2: Yes, built-in electric
ovens can be fixed. Nevertheless, it is advised to employ specialists for repair work due to the complex installation. Q3: Do built-in ovens take longer to install compared to freestanding models?A3: Yes, built-in ovens generally require more
intricate setup procedures, which might involve cabinetry changes, electrical circuitry, and leveling. Q4: What is the typical life-span of a built-in electric intergrated oven?A4: A well-maintained built-in electric oven can last between 10 to 15 years.
